Jackson Square
Today, the French Quarter offers an exciting vision of the historic greatness of New Orleans with its narrow streets, French and Spanish architecture, and the oldest cathedral and apartment buildings in America. Courtyards, patios, intriguing alleys, artists, musicians on every corner, outdoor markets, and a wide array of internationally famous restaurants make the French Quarter the heart of New Orleans!

Washington Artillery Park
The name is now, Oscar Dunn park. It is a grand view of the Mississippi River , overlooks Jackson Square and a high point view of the French Quarter
